August Weather at Clinton Municipal Airport Iowa, United States

Daily high temperatures decrease by 4°F, from 83°F to 79°F, rarely falling below 70°F or exceeding 91°F.

Daily low temperatures decrease by 4°F, from 63°F to 59°F, rarely falling below 49°F or exceeding 71°F.

For reference, on July 18, the hottest day of the year, temperatures at Clinton Municipal Airport typically range from 64°F to 84°F, while on January 22, the coldest day of the year, they range from 14°F to 29°F.

The month of August at Clinton Municipal Airport experiences essentially constant cloud cover, with the percentage of time that the sky is overcast or mostly cloudy remaining about 32% throughout the month. The lowest chance of overcast or mostly cloudy conditions is 31% on August 25.

The clearest day of the month is August 25, with clear, mostly clear, or partly cloudy conditions 69% of the time.

For reference, on December 28, the cloudiest day of the year, the chance of overcast or mostly cloudy conditions is 57%, while on August 25, the clearest day of the year, the chance of clear, mostly clear, or partly cloudy skies is 69%.

A wet day is one with at least 0.04 inches of liquid or liquid-equivalent precipitation. At Clinton Municipal Airport, the chance of a wet day over the course of August is decreasing, starting the month at 36% and ending it at 32%.

For reference, the year's highest daily chance of a wet day is 41% on June 13, and its lowest chance is 12% on January 29.

Rainfall

To show variation within the month and not just the monthly total, we show the rainfall accumulated over a sliding 31-day period centered around each day.

The average sliding 31-day rainfall during August at Clinton Municipal Airport is essentially constant, remaining about 3.5 inches throughout, and rarely exceeding 6.6 inches or falling below 1.4 inches.

Over the course of August at Clinton Municipal Airport, the length of the day is rapidly decreasing. From the start to the end of the month, the length of the day decreases by 1 hour, 14 minutes, implying an average daily decrease of 2 minutes, 28 seconds, and weekly decrease of 17 minutes, 19 seconds.

The shortest day of the month is August 31, with 13 hours, 9 minutes of daylight and the longest day is August 1, with 14 hours, 23 minutes of daylight.

The earliest sunrise of the month at Clinton Municipal Airport is 5:55 AM on August 1 and the latest sunrise is 31 minutes later at 6:26 AM on August 31.

The latest sunset is 8:18 PM on August 1 and the earliest sunset is 43 minutes earlier at 7:35 PM on August 31.

Daylight saving time is observed at Clinton Municipal Airport during 2024, but it neither starts nor ends during August, so the entire month is in standard time.

For reference, on June 20, the longest day of the year, the Sun rises at 5:26 AM and sets 15 hours, 13 minutes later, at 8:39 PM, while on December 21, the shortest day of the year, it rises at 7:25 AM and sets 9 hours, 8 minutes later, at 4:33 PM.

We base the humidity comfort level on the dew point, as it determines whether perspiration will evaporate from the skin, thereby cooling the body. Lower dew points feel drier and higher dew points feel more humid. Unlike temperature, which typically varies significantly between night and day, dew point tends to change more slowly, so while the temperature may drop at night, a muggy day is typically followed by a muggy night.

The chance that a given day will be muggy at Clinton Municipal Airport is rapidly decreasing during August, falling from 42% to 25% over the course of the month.

For reference, on July 20, the muggiest day of the year, there are muggy conditions 44% of the time, while on January 1, the least muggy day of the year, there are muggy conditions 0% of the time.

This section discusses the wide-area hourly average wind vector (speed and direction) at 10 meters above the ground. The wind experienced at any given location is highly dependent on local topography and other factors, and instantaneous wind speed and direction vary more widely than hourly averages.

The average hourly wind speed at Clinton Municipal Airport is gradually increasing during August, increasing from 7.6 miles per hour to 8.3 miles per hour over the course of the month.

For reference, on March 22, the windiest day of the year, the daily average wind speed is 12.4 miles per hour, while on August 2, the calmest day of the year, the daily average wind speed is 7.6 miles per hour.

The lowest daily average wind speed during August is 7.6 miles per hour on August 2.

Definitions of the growing season vary throughout the world, but for the purposes of this report, we define it as the longest continuous period of non-freezing temperatures (≥ 32°F) in the year (the calendar year in the Northern Hemisphere, or from July 1 until June 30 in the Southern Hemisphere).

The growing season at Clinton Municipal Airport typically lasts for 5.6 months (171 days), from around April 21 to around October 9, rarely starting before April 1 or after May 8, and rarely ending before September 19 or after October 28.

The month of August at Clinton Municipal Airport is reliably fully within the growing season.

Growing degree days are a measure of yearly heat accumulation used to predict plant and animal development, and defined as the integral of warmth above a base temperature, discarding any excess above a maximum temperature. In this report, we use a base of 50°F and a cap of 86°F.

The average accumulated growing degree days at Clinton Municipal Airport are rapidly increasing during August, increasing by 616°F, from 1,890°F to 2,506°F, over the course of the month.

This section discusses the total daily incident shortwave solar energy reaching the surface of the ground over a wide area, taking full account of seasonal variations in the length of the day, the elevation of the Sun above the horizon, and absorption by clouds and other atmospheric constituents. Shortwave radiation includes visible light and ultraviolet radiation.

The average daily incident shortwave solar energy at Clinton Municipal Airport is gradually decreasing during August, falling by 0.9 kWh, from 6.5 kWh to 5.6 kWh, over the course of the month.

For the purposes of this report, the geographical coordinates of Clinton Municipal Airport are 41.831 deg latitude, -90.329 deg longitude, and 689 ft elevation.

The topography within 2 miles of Clinton Municipal Airport contains only modest variations in elevation, with a maximum elevation change of 128 feet and an average elevation above sea level of 681 feet. Within 10 miles also contains only modest variations in elevation (331 feet). Within 50 miles contains only modest variations in elevation (778 feet).

The area within 2 miles of Clinton Municipal Airport is covered by cropland (100%), within 10 miles by cropland (82%), and within 50 miles by cropland (87%).

This report illustrates the typical weather at Clinton Municipal Airport, based on a statistical analysis of historical hourly weather reports and model reconstructions from January 1, 1980 to December 31, 2016.

Temperature and Dew Point

Clinton Municipal Airport has a weather station that reported reliably enough during the analysis period that we have included it in our network. When available, historical temperature and dew point measurements are taken directly from this weather station. These records are obtained from NOAA's Integrated Surface Hourly data set, falling back on ICAO METAR records as required.

In the case of missing or erroneous measurements from this station, we fall back on records from nearby stations, adjusted according to typical seasonal and diurnal intra-station differences. For a given day of the year and hour of the day, the fallback station is selected to minimize the prediction error over the years for which there are measurements for both stations.

The stations on which we may fall back include but are not limited to Tri-Township Airport, Davenport Municipal Airport, Quad City International Airport, Sterling Rockfalls, Dubuque Regional Airport, Albertus Airport, Platteville Municipal Airport, and Galesburg Municipal Airport.

Other Data

All data relating to the Sun's position (e.g., sunrise and sunset) are computed using astronomical formulas from the book, Astronomical Algorithms 2nd Edition , by Jean Meeus.

All other weather data, including cloud cover, precipitation, wind speed and direction, and solar flux, come from NASA's MERRA-2 Modern-Era Retrospective Analysis . This reanalysis combines a variety of wide-area measurements in a state-of-the-art global meteorological model to reconstruct the hourly history of weather throughout the world on a 50-kilometer grid.

Land Use data comes from the Global Land Cover SHARE database , published by the Food and Agriculture Organization of the United Nations.

Elevation data comes from the Shuttle Radar Topography Mission (SRTM) , published by NASA's Jet Propulsion Laboratory.

Names, locations, and time zones of places and some airports come from the GeoNames Geographical Database .

Time zones for airports and weather stations are provided by AskGeo.com .
